For the second year in a row, a major economic development project in Louisiana has been recognized by Business Facilities as the Platinum Deal of the Year. Governor Jeff Landry says Business Facilities has recognized the Hyundai Steel mill in Ascension Parish as the nation’s most significant development announcement of 2025.
“Nearly $6 billion of investment, and the first steel mill in 60 years to be built from the ground up,” Landry said.
Hyundai Steel will build its steel mill on a 1,700-acre site in Donaldsonville. The project was announced last March at the White House, and it’s expected to generate more than 5,400 jobs. Landry says the honor follows Louisiana’s 2024 Platinum Award for the Meta AI data center in Richland Parish.
“These back-to-back wins show that Louisiana is open for business,” Landry said.
Landry says Louisiana is the first state to earn back-to-back top honors.
